Emmanuel Kanu, who is also known as “fine boy”, said the soldiers did not find his brother, thought to be the target of the visit.Meanwhile, speaking in a live telephone interview on Channels Television, monitored by a TORI News correspondent on Friday, Nnamdi Kanu said the military killed 22 people, almost shot dead his father and also killed the family’s only dog during his home invasion by the military at the Afarauku area of Umuahia, the Abia state capital.The spokesman of 14 Brigade Ohafia, Oyegoke Gbadamosi, a major, declined to speak on the allegations, while the deputy director, army public relations 82 Division Enugu, Sagir Musa, a colonel, did not pick his call.
